Bernhardtjørna
Bernhardtjørna is a pond in Rana Municipality, Nordland. Bernhardtjørna is situated nearby to the locality Skamdalsaksla, as well as near the hamlet Urdlandet.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Bjerka
Village
Photo: Røed, CC BY-SA 2.5.
Bjerka is a village in Hemnes Municipality in Nordland county, Norway. It is located along the European route E6 highway and the Nordland Line, about 20 kilometres southeast of Hemnesberget and about 7 kilometres north of the municipal center of Korgen.
